What does a junior cloud engineer intern do?

A Junior Cloud Engineer Intern assists in designing, implementing, and maintaining cloud-based solutions under the guidance of senior engineers. They typically work with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ud to help set up infrastructure, automate processes, and monitor system performance. Interns may also help troubleshoot issues, document processes, and learn about security and best practices in the cloud environment. This role provides hands-on experience and foundational skills needed for a career in cloud engineering.

What types of projects and tasks can a junior cloud engineer intern expect to work on during their internship?

As a Junior Cloud Engineer Intern, you can expect to assist with deploying, configuring, and monitoring cloud infrastructure under the guidance of senior engineers. Typical tasks may include helping to automate workflows using tools like Terraform or AWS CloudFormation, supporting troubleshooting efforts, and learning about cloud security best practices. You'll likely collaborate closely with development and operations teams, participate in team meetings, and contribute to documentation. This exposure provides a valuable foundation for understanding cloud architectures and workflows, while building technical and teamwork skills essential for a future in cloud engineering.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a junior cloud engineer int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ior Cloud Engineer Intern, you need a basic understanding of cloud computing concepts, programming fundamentals, and familiarity with platforms like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ud, often supported by relevant coursework or entry-level certifications. Hands-on experience with tools such as the AWS Management Console, CLI, and infrastructure-as-code solutions like Terraform or CloudFormation is valuable. Eagerness to learn, problem-solving skills, and effective teamwork help interns stand out in collaborative and dynamic cloud environments. These skills are vital for efficiently supporting cloud operations, adapting to new technologies, and contributing to team projects in a rapidly evolving field.

Job description

Watch the 3-min video to learn about Whova's culture

Whova is seeking a Software Engineer Intern (2026 Summer)! In this role, you will join a team to deliver best-in-class products to our users. If you’re passionate about Web Development and are looking for a unique opportunity to have an impact on the way people network in the numerous events, consider joining us at Whova.

Whova revolutionizes event engagement and attendee networking by providing the Whova mobile app and event management software for conferences and trade shows globally every day.

Whova is a fast-growing company with brand-name customers, including US-Bank, L’Oreal, Hilton, LEGO, Vetafore, NASA, IKEA, TEDx, etc. We are proud to receive the Best Places to Work in San Diego award, 5 years in a row. We also won the Fastest Growing Private Companies award for 3 years. More recently, we won Event Technology Awards’ Best Product Team Award, and Global Top Rated Product Award. Currently, we are named as G2’s Global Top 50 Best Software.

Responsibilities
  • Build scalable front-end applications to support the growing needs of the business
  • Design, develop and deploy backend services with the focus on high availability, low latency, and scalability
  • Help improve our code quality through writing unit tests, automation and performing code reviews
  • Work with the product and design teams to understand end-user requirements, formulate use cases, and then translate that into a pragmatic and effective technical solution
  • Dive into difficult problems and successfully deliver results on schedule
Desired Skills & Experience
  • Required Education: Currently enrolled as a Junior, Senior, Master’s, or Doctoral student
  • Major groups: Computer Science, Computer Programming, Computer Engineering, Computer Systems Networking & Telecommunications
  • You have a deep understanding of how the computer system works
  • You have a good understanding of data structures and algorithms, and understand how to apply them to design pragmatic solutions
